Sissòn (b. 1986) is a self-taught American artist. Their work reveals and questions the experience and social constructs of race, identity, and power. Born in Los Angeles and raised in Glendale, Arizona, Sissòn began their creative curriculum at age seven under the tutelage of their mother, Kimberlin.
